PHP Класс PHPUnit_TextUI_TestRunner, phpunit

Наследование: extends PHPUnit_Runner_BaseTestRunner
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$codeCoverageFilter SebastianBergmann\CodeCoverage\Filter
$loader PHPUnit_Runner_TestSuiteLoader
$printer PHPUnit_TextUI_ResultPrinter
$versionStringPrinted boolean

Открытые методы

Метод Описание
__construct ( PHPUnit_Runner_TestSuiteLoader $loader = null, SebastianBergmann\CodeCoverage\Filter $filter = null )
doRun ( PHPUnit_Framework_Test $suite, array $arguments = [], boolean $exit = true ) : PHPUnit_Framework_TestResult
getLoader ( ) : PHPUnit_Runner_TestSuiteLoader Returns the loader to be used.
run ( PHPUnit_Framework_Test | ReflectionClass $test, array $arguments = [] ) : PHPUnit_Framework_TestResult
setPrinter ( PHPUnit_TextUI_ResultPrinter $resultPrinter )

Защищенные методы

Метод Описание
createTestResult ( ) : PHPUnit_Framework_TestResult
handleConfiguration ( array &$arguments )
runFailed ( string $message ) Override to define how to handle a failed loading of a test suite.
write ( string $buffer )

Приватные методы

Метод Описание
processSuiteFilters ( PHPUnit_Framework_TestSuite $suite, array $arguments )
writeMessage ( string $type, string $message )

Описание методов

__construct() публичный Метод

public __construct ( PHPUnit_Runner_TestSuiteLoader $loader = null, SebastianBergmann\CodeCoverage\Filter $filter = null )
$loader PHPUnit_Runner_TestSuiteLoader
$filter SebastianBergmann\CodeCoverage\Filter

createTestResult() защищенный Метод

protected createTestResult ( ) : PHPUnit_Framework_TestResult
Результат PHPUnit_Framework_TestResult

doRun() публичный Метод

public doRun ( PHPUnit_Framework_Test $suite, array $arguments = [], boolean $exit = true ) : PHPUnit_Framework_TestResult
$suite PHPUnit_Framework_Test
$arguments array
$exit boolean
Результат PHPUnit_Framework_TestResult

getLoader() публичный Метод

Returns the loader to be used.
public getLoader ( ) : PHPUnit_Runner_TestSuiteLoader
Результат PHPUnit_Runner_TestSuiteLoader

handleConfiguration() защищенный Метод

protected handleConfiguration ( array &$arguments )
$arguments array

run() публичный статический Метод

public static run ( PHPUnit_Framework_Test | ReflectionClass $test, array $arguments = [] ) : PHPUnit_Framework_TestResult
$test PHPUnit_Framework_Test | ReflectionClass
$arguments array
Результат PHPUnit_Framework_TestResult

runFailed() защищенный Метод

Override to define how to handle a failed loading of a test suite.
protected runFailed ( string $message )
$message string

setPrinter() публичный Метод

public setPrinter ( PHPUnit_TextUI_ResultPrinter $resultPrinter )
$resultPrinter PHPUnit_TextUI_ResultPrinter

write() защищенный Метод

protected write ( string $buffer )
$buffer string

Описание свойств

$codeCoverageFilter защищенное свойство

protected Filter,SebastianBergmann\CodeCoverage $codeCoverageFilter
Результат SebastianBergmann\CodeCoverage\Filter

$loader защищенное свойство

protected PHPUnit_Runner_TestSuiteLoader $loader
Результат PHPUnit_Runner_TestSuiteLoader

$printer защищенное свойство

protected PHPUnit_TextUI_ResultPrinter $printer
Результат PHPUnit_TextUI_ResultPrinter

$versionStringPrinted защищенное статическое свойство

protected static bool $versionStringPrinted
Результат boolean